Costus juruanus 'Dazzler'


OLD NAME: Costus productus 'Dazzler'

NEW NAME: Costus juruanus 'Dazzler'

NAME CHANGE NOTES: Form of Costus juruanus

FULL SCIENTIFIC NAME:

STATUS : registered cultivar

CONTINENT: Neotropical

BOTANICAL NOTES:
Published December 2019, Heliconia Society Bulletin, Vol. 25, No. 4

This form of Costus juruanus grows to about half a meter tall. It has large silvery grey leaves that glisten in the sunlight. The large red inflorescences with yellow flowers contrast well against the leaves and it makes a nice compact, but showy plant for the garden.
